About Community Legal Services

Based on IRS filings

Community Legal Services is a nonprofit organization focused on Crime & Legal Related, based in EAST PALO ALTO, CA. IRS filing data is available from 2020 through 2024. As of 2024, the organization holds $8.1M in total assets. In 2024, it awarded 2 grants totaling $27K. Net investment income was $85K.
